Output c326b8f591836e9764281f835361ae23980000271dac04640fd04f890579783c:3

value
650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44b822b89c05d2385359d10b4077304845d7d086 OP_EQUALVERIFY OP_CHECKSIG
address
17GMY1iMf5dmJJBukReYWP7GaQz6wWaWxh
transaction
c326b8f591836e9764281f835361ae23980000271dac04640fd04f890579783c
spent
true